Filing statistics
IPC E21B 10/02 belongs to the parent subclass E21B, which recorded 363,999 patent applications worldwide between 2013 and 2023. Annual filings grew from 30,128 in 2013 to 33,441 in 2023 (+11%), peaking at 39,369 applications in 2020. The most active applicants in class E21 are HALLIBURTON ENERGY SERVICES GROUP (26,607 applications), PETROCHINA COMPANY (14,382 applications) and SINOPEC (CHINA PETROCHEMICAL CORPORATION) (10,137 applications).
